Category:Fictional characters by status

The following is an archived discussion concerning one or more categories. Please do not modify it. Subsequent comments should be made on an appropriate discussion page (such as the category's talk page or in a deletion review). No further edits should be made to this section.
The result of the discussion was: merge. MER-C 08:34, 14 July 2019 (UTC)[reply]
Nominator's rationale: merge, a case of WP:OCMISC, the subcategories have nothing specifically in common with each other apart from the fact that they are about fictional characters. Marcocapelle (talk) 08:56, 14 June 2019 (UTC)[reply]
  • Weak merge The real-world Category:People by status includes articles regarding death, existence, or legal status. Most of the contents of this category, save for Category:Fictional victims, bear no relation to these. If we are to use the same coherent definition of "status" as the real-world category, we would remove all categories except for Category:Fictional victims and possibly Category:Fictional deaths by cause, Category:Fictional orphans, Category:Fictional clones, and Category:Fictional sole survivors. (The latter has no real-world equivalent for some reason.) That would make up to 5 subcategories, enough for a keep. With regards to the rest:
    • the inclusion of Category:Fictional offspring of incestuous relationships and Category:Fictional offspring of rape, which also have no real-world analogs, is unclear;
    • some of the subcategories are already in Category:Fictional victims;
    • Category:Merged fictional characters is probably better described as an "attribute" rather than a "status";
    • the subcategories by medium, Category:Anime and manga characters by status and Category:Video game characters by status, have the same problems as this category and should be included in this nomination; and
    • the subcategories not mentioned in this comment are clearly not "statuses", but rather "attributes" or "characterizations". –LaundryPizza03 (d) 03:38, 18 June 2019 (UTC)[reply]

Category:Public universities in Greece

The following is an archived discussion concerning one or more categories. Please do not modify it. Subsequent comments should be made on an appropriate discussion page (such as the category's talk page or in a deletion review). No further edits should be made to this section.
The result of the discussion was: merge. MER-C 08:34, 14 July 2019 (UTC)[reply]
Nominator's rationale: In Greece, all universities are public, as mentioned for instance here. There is therefore no reason to single out the 3 universities currently in this category from the other universities. Place Clichy (talk) 12:44, 11 June 2019 (UTC)[reply]
